Purchasing Agent Responsibilities:
- Initiate, prepare, process, and verify purchase orders in accordance with established guidelines, ensuring materials and goods are acquired by required delivery dates.
- Input transactions and manage a purchasing and contracts system or database efficiently.
- Engage with suppliers to negotiate favorable pricing terms, obtain product specifications, monitor availability, and optimize savings.
- Expedite delayed orders and effectively resolve issues of changes, returns, replacements, and credit arrangements.
- Collaborate closely with internal teams to promptly and efficiently meet procurement needs.
- High school diploma or equivalent.
- 1-2 years of relevant experience in procurement or a related field.
- Proficiency in executing a wide range of complex duties independently, with general guidance from supervisors.
- Strong negotiation skills and ability to establish productive relationships with suppliers.
- Excellent problem-solving abilities and a proactive approach to resolving issues.
- Familiarity with purchasing and contracts systems or databases.
- Effective communication and coordination skills to work collaboratively with internal teams.
